Despite ceasing development on Cyberpunk 2077, CD Projekt RED is far from done with its hit title and has surprised fans with some free new downloads.

Perhaps to celebrate its recent announcement that Cyberpunk 2077 has sold an incredible 30 million copies since launch, CD Projekt RED is rewarding fans with more of what they love - Night City.

No, it isn’t a new game or anything directly linked to the game but it is definitely an exciting download for fans of the 2020 RPG.

Thanks to fans reaching out following the official Cyberpunk 2077 Twitter account posting new artwork earlier this week, CDPR has released the art as digital downloads which would make for perfect wallpapers and phone backgrounds.

“You matter,” the tweet reads. "Highly requested wallpapers inspired by the City of Dreams trailer just dropped!”

The link takes you to the official website where six new wallpapers have been added in a variety of different sizes.

The first is of female V standing out in the crowd and the others consist of scenery from the North Oak, Japantown, Downtown and Corporate Plaza areas of the map, finishing off with a mirrored photo but this time of male V.

It is safe to say that they are all stunning and are getting fans hyped for the highly-anticipated Cyberpunk 2077 sequel.

In reply to the tweet, one comment read: “The love you show the entire community needs to be made an example, it's that good.”

Another said: “I LOVED Night City. Easily one of the best open world locations in gaming. Would love the sequel to take place in an expanded version of NC. More interior places, underground subway systems etc.”

CDPR is currently hard at work developing Cyberpunk 2 but until then, at least we can gaze upon the beauty of the original in 4K.
